Study on serum LAM-IgG for the diagnosis of tuberculosis

Abstract

Objective:To investigate the value of LAM-IgG in the diagnosis,differential diagnosis and prognosis judgment of tuberculosis so as to provide a basis for diagnosis and treatment of tuberculosis.Methods:The LAM-IgG in serum were detected with Enzyme-linked immunosorbent assay(ELISA).SPSS13.0 statistical software was used for data statistics.Results:The positive rate of LAM-IgG in active pulmonary tuberculosis,non-active pulmonary tuberculosis,extra-pulmonary tuberculosis and the control group were 88.5%,28.6%,83.3%,3.2%,respectively.The positive rate of LAM-IgG in the case group was higher than the control group(P0.05).The positive rates of LAM-IgG in active pulmonary tuberculosis group and extra-pulmonary were higher than non-active tuberculosis(P0.05).The sensitivity,specificity,accuracy of LAM-IgG in the diagnosis of active pulmonary tuberculosis and extra-pulmonary tuberculosis groups were 86.4%,83.3%,90.7%.Conclusion:LAM-IgG have a higher sensitivity,specificity,accuracy in the diagnosis of active pulmonary tuberculosis and extra-pulmonary tuberculosis.It can be used as an indicator of diagnosis,differential diagnosis and prognosis judgment of tuberculosis in the active pulmonary and extra-pulmonary tuberculosis.
